invisiblog.com (beta) - anonymous weblog publishing Unlike other blogging and hosting services, Invisiblog doesn't have access to any potentially sensitive information about you - not even your email or IP address. All contact between bloggers and invisiblog.com is via the Mixmaster anonymous remailer network, which uses encryption and 'mixnet' techniques to hide the source of an email. hiding email addresses - Sarven Capadisli I've compiled a list of methods for hiding email addresses from the page source, to rebel against the email spam bots. Each method has its (dis)advantages, therefore I leave it up to the reader to decide which method suits them the most, as there are many factors. A list of methods to hide email address from spam harvester bots using; css, javascript, forms, images, obfuscation, authentication, unicode, encryption, flash and more.
